How Our Garage Water Damage Cleanup Process Works
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that every aspect of your garage water damage is addressed. We’ll work closely with you to identify the source of the damage, assess the extent of the problem, and develop a customized plan to restore your property to its original condition. By following a structured approach, we can reduce downtime, prevent further damage, and get you back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the damage, identify any safety hazards, and find out the best course of action.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ring that our cleanup process is effective. Our technician will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ify areas that need attention.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once we’ve assessed the damage, we’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the standing water from your garage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age, reducing the risk of mold growth, and making the drying process more efficient. Our technicians will work quickly and carefully to ensure that every area of your garage is thoroughly dry.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your garage and remove any excess mo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th, reducing the risk of further damage, and making the restoration process more efficient. Our technicians will work closely with you to ensure that your garage is thoroughly dry and ready for restoration.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your garage is dry, we’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any dirt, debris, and contaminants that may have accumulated during the damage. This step is critical in preventing the growth of mold and mildew, reducing the risk of further damage, and making your garage safe and healthy to use.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your garage to its original condition. This may involve repairing any damaged drywall, replacing any affected flooring, and making any necessary cosmetic repairs. Our technicians will work closely with you to ensure that your garage is safe, healthy, and functional once again.

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Duncanville, TX
The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Duncanville,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of garage water damage cleanup: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water present |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, extent of moisture damage |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, extent of dirt and debris damage |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, extent of damage, materials required |
| Emergency services (after hours) | $500 – $2,000 | Time of day, level of urgency |
